Solid pseudopapillary tumor (SPT) of the pancreas is a rare benign or low-grade malignant epithelial tumor that occurs mainly in young females in second to fourth decades of life. Pathologic and ...imaging findings include a well-defined, encapsulated pancreatic mass with cystic and solid components with evidence of hemorrhage. We report a 23-year-old female who presented with upper abdominal pain of long duration and epigastric mass on palpation. Multidetector-row CT (MDCT) demonstrated a large well-defined heterogeneous attenuation mass, containing hyperdense areas of hemorrhage mixed with solid enhancing and cystic non-enhancing areas, arising from the pancreatic body and tail. Splenic vein thrombosis was present with dilated splenoportal collateral vessels between splenic hilum and portal/superior mesenteric veins, with dilated vessels seen in the gastric wall, with patent portal vein, compatible with sinistral portal hypertension. Typical imaging features and age and sex of the patient suggested a diagnosis of SPT of pancreas complicated by segmental portal hypertension due to splenic vein thrombosis. Histopathology of the biopsy material was confirmatory.
Ultra-wideband is increasingly advancing as a high data rate wireless technology after the Federal Communication Commission announced the bandwidth of 7.5 GHz (from 3.1 GHz to 10.6 GHz) for ...ultra-wideband applications. Furthermore, designing a UWB antenna faces more difficulties than designing a narrow band antenna. A suitable UWB antenna should be able to work over the Federal Communication Commission of ultra-wide bandwidth allocation. Furthermore, good radiation properties across the entire frequency spectrum are needed. This paper outlines an optimization of fractal square microstrip patch antenna with the partial ground using a genetic algorithm at 3.5 GHz and 6 GHz. The optimized antenna design shows improved results compared to the non-optimized design. This design is optimized using a genetic algorithm and simulated using CST simulation software. The size of the optimized design is reduced by cutting the edges and the center of the patch. The optimized results reported, and concentrated on the rerun loss, VSWR and gain. The results indicate a significant enhancement as is illustrated in Table II. Thus, the optimized design is suitable for S-band and C-band applications.
The use of illicit drugs has become an increasingly serious problem among various sections of the Bangladesh population. However, there has been almost no research on the use of illicit drugs by ...Bangladeshi people. This paper examines drug use patterns and the social circumstances within which drug-taking behaviour took place among a sample of different target groups. The study incorporated a semi-structured qualitative interview and a structured quantitative questionnaire. Demographic and drug use information was collected from a total of 154 drug users. Approximately three-quarters of the subjects reported that they had used alcohol and ganja in the month prior to being interviewed. The findings revealed interesting differences between the groups. For example, the student group was found to use phensidyl syrup (67%) more often than those of other groups and did not differ significantly in the use of ganja. The use of heroin and sedatives was widespread, with nearly one-third of subjects (40%) reporting having injected these drugs. The majority (41%) of most recent drug use occurred in conjunction with a group of people. Drug use was associated with frustration, peer pressure, family problems and curiosity. Peer education programs are likely to be the most effective harm reduction approach among new drug users. The implications of these findings are discussed.
We compared the applicability of an enhanced chemiluminescent (ECL) method for using gene probes with that of radioactive probes to identify enterotoxigenic Escherichia coli (ETEC) in stools of ...Bangladeshi children with diarrhoea. Colony blots of E. coli isolates were hybridized using both α-32P-dCTP labelled and fluorescein-11-dUTP labelled polynucleotide and oligonucleotide gene probes for heat-labile enterotoxin (LT), and heat-stable enterotoxin (ST). Analysis of 1,620 isolates obtained from 540 patients gave similar results by both radioactive and chemiluminescent probes. The ECL method was faster than the radioactive method. Both polynucleotide and oligonucleotide probes could be used by the ECL method. Hybridization and detection by the ECL method appeared to be a convenient alternative to radioactive probes for screening E. coli isolates for ETEC.
Six hundred and seventy-five Escherichia coli isolates obtained from 225 diarrhoeal children less than five years of age were tested for adherence to HeLa cells and for hybridisation with DNA probes ...for genes conferring aggregative adherence (AggA), localised adherence (LA) and diffuse adherence (DA) to assess the usefulness of a recently developed DNA probe for AggA of enteroaggregative E. coli (EAggEC). The strains were further analysed with the DNA probes for heat-labile enterotoxin (LT), heat-stable enterotoxin (ST), Shiga-like toxins (SLT I and SLT II) and for enteroinvasiveness and adherent strains were all negative for these properties. The HeLa cell assay and DNA probe assays showed excellent agreement in identifying LA and DA positive isolates. However, significant disparities occurred in the case of AggA positive isolates, and the DNA probe failed to identify 31.9% (15 of 47) of the EAggEC identified by the HeLa cell adherence assay. The failure of the DNA probe to identify all the EAggEC indicated that there may be a high degree of genetic heterogeneity for the expression of AggA, and development of more DNA probes is necessary to detect all the possible genetic variants of EAggEC.
